It’s an electronic trading platform used by millions of currency traders. It can also be used as an automated forex trading software, by using Expert Advisors (EA) coded in the MQL 4 (Metaquotes) language.

Basically what this means is that with your computer running, this software can trade for you while you’re at work, playing golf, whatever… And if you don’t want your computer running when you’re away, one can even use it on a VPS server.

So you (or an EA programmer) can code your own EAs and Custom Indicators and back test the results by using the back testing function and the historical data base this software is equipped with. How far back the historical data goes depends on the time frame used, i.e. H1 (hourly rates) goes back to 1999, as of this writing.

For a beginner in Forex trading, this software offers a no cost entry (excluding Broker Spread) into the Foreign Exchange trading world and another positive side is that most serious Forex Brokers these days now have a MT4 or MT5 platform option available, usually through either a Demo or Live account download.

Demo accounts usually expire after 30 days but in MT it’s easy to open a new one, so the trader can use it for another 30 days and so on. This can be done by right clicking the Account folder in the Navigator window and then click ‘Open an account’ on the menu.

A convenient feature with this broker is the option for Micro-Lot trading, which for a beginning Forex trader is a great, low risk start to Live trading, which makes it possible to open positions with very small Stop Losses in terms of money, but still have plenty of Stop Loss room in terms of Pips.

This is recommended in my view, until getting more experienced and can increase Lot sizes, with the goal of becoming profitable in the long run. Trading with real money (not only Demo trading) in this way, will gradually and better learn the trader how to deal with trading emotions connected to Profits, Losses, Greed and Fear, without doing too much damage to his mind and trading account, in the process.
